Three concrete AI opportunities with ROI framing
1. Intelligent patient access and triage. The highest-leverage opportunity is an AI layer on top of the patient intake process. By using natural language processing on web forms and chatbot conversations, One Health Direct can automatically assess urgency and route patients to the appropriate virtual or in-person visit. This reduces the clinical hours spent on manual triage by an estimated 40%, allowing providers to handle larger panels without sacrificing care quality. The ROI is immediate: fewer unnecessary specialist referrals and better utilization of provider schedules.
2. Predictive revenue cycle management. Denied claims and coding errors are a silent drain on mid-sized practices. Machine learning models trained on historical remittance data can flag high-risk claims before submission. For a practice of this scale, improving the clean claim rate by just 5% can recover $200,000–$500,000 annually in otherwise lost revenue. This is a behind-the-scenes AI application that requires no patient-facing change, minimizing adoption friction.
3. Ambient clinical documentation. Generative AI scribes that listen to patient-provider conversations and draft clinical notes are rapidly maturing. For a telehealth-heavy organization, this technology integrates directly with video platforms. Reducing daily charting time by two hours per clinician dramatically fights burnout and increases the number of patients a provider can see, delivering a hard ROI through increased visit capacity.
Deployment risks specific to this size band
The primary risk is integration complexity. A 201-500 employee company likely uses a core EHR and several bolt-on point solutions. AI tools must fit into this ecosystem without requiring a custom data warehouse build. Vendor lock-in and hidden professional services fees can quickly erode ROI. Second, HIPAA compliance cannot be an afterthought; any AI touching patient data requires a rigorous Business Associate Agreement and audit trail. Finally, clinician buy-in is critical. Without a strong clinical champion to demonstrate that AI reduces administrative burden rather than adding surveillance, tools will be abandoned. A phased rollout starting with revenue cycle or scheduling—areas clinicians support—builds trust before introducing clinical decision support.
